Prince’s Gettin’ Famous: Hot Chicken Spreading Like Wildfire

Little did we know when we posted this review of Prince’s Hot Chicken Shack that hot chicken was going to be the buzz of the summer. It seems that more and more people are discovering the glory that is a firey piece of fried chicken, particularly from Prince’s, and this Slashfood article blames it on something they call “Hot Chicken Syndrome.” The majority of what Slashfood has to say is a bit on the fluffy side, as evidenced by the opening:

True to cliché, countless failed country stars stream out of Nashville with their money spent, spirits broken and nothing but a nasty hot chicken habit to show for their Music City sojourn. It’s an addiction many twangsters say they just can’t kick.

But we can’t argue with the premise. Hot chicken is dang good, and addictive, and all that and a bag of chips. That’s why we have an entire festival devoted to devouring hot chicken (and it’s coming up soon).
